Pest Control contractors in Vero Beach, Florida.

Operating a pest control business in Vero Beach, Florida, requires strict adherence to both state-level agricultural regulations and local municipal business requirements. The Florida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services (FDACS) serves as the primary regulatory authority, overseeing the licensing of businesses, certified operators, and individual technicians. Compliance is mandatory for all pesticide application activities to ensure public safety and environmental protection.

At the local level, contractors must secure a Business Tax Receipt (BTR) from both the City of Vero Beach and Indian River County. While standard pest control services do not typically trigger building permit requirements, any structural work associated with fumigation or exclusion services should be vetted through the Indian River County Building Division. Maintaining current insurance and accurate records of pesticide use is essential for ongoing compliance.

What's specific to Vero BeachWhat this leaf carries beyond the Florida state file.
Subtropical Climate Focus
Vero Beach's humid climate requires specific expertise in termite and wood-destroying organism (WDO) control unique to the Treasure Coast.
Environmental Sensitivity
Proximity to the Indian River Lagoon necessitates strict adherence to local ordinances regarding pesticide runoff and water protection.
Dual-Jurisdiction BTR
Contractors must navigate both City of Vero Beach and Indian River County tax systems, which is distinct from unincorporated areas.

§ 07 · Vero Beach-specific FAQ

Questions Pest Control contractors ask about Vero Beach.

Q01Do I need a local permit for every pest control job in Vero Beach?+
No, standard pest control applications do not require building permits, but you must hold a valid Business Tax Receipt from the City of Vero Beach.
PermitsLocalSource · City of Vero Beach Finance Department
Q02What state agency regulates pest control in Florida?+
The Florida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services (FDACS) Bureau of Entomology and Pest Control regulates the industry.
StateRegulationSource · FDACS
Q03Are there specific insurance minimums for pest control?+
Yes, Florida Statutes Chapter 482 mandates specific liability coverage amounts for pest control operators.
InsuranceLiabilitySource · Florida Statute 482.071
Q04Is reciprocity available for out-of-state licenses?+
Florida does not offer direct reciprocity; out-of-state operators must pass the Florida state examination to be certified.
LicensingReciprocitySource · FDACS
Q05Do my employees need individual licenses?+
Employees must hold an Identification Card issued by the business and registered with FDACS to perform work.
EmployeesCertificationSource · FDACS
Q06Where do I file for my local business tax?+
You must file with the Indian River County Tax Collector for the county receipt and the City of Vero Beach Finance Department for the city receipt.
